The Republicans appear to have one less thing to worry about as they kick off this week’s potentially rowdy National Convention in Cleveland. Algae experts are forecasting that much of the thick blanket of smelly algae—which in the past two summers has toxified as much as 60 percent of Lake Erie, killed fish, made beaches unswimmable, and cost 400,000 Ohioans access to drinking water—is pulling a no-show.

It isn’t that Ohio has actually done anything new to significantly reduce known drivers of algae blooms—fertilizer runoff from agriculture as well as added nitrogen, thermal discharging and increased CO2 emissions from power plants. This summer, the state just got lucky with a lower-than-average rainfall, meaning that less fertilizer was swept from fields into the lake via smaller streams and rivers. ...
